In this paper, a model following control problem (NMFCP, for short) for nonlinear MIMO systems is studied. Isurugi and Shima has already given the solution of this problem under some regularity assumptions. The result can be stated as follows: NMFCP is solvable iff the relative order of the plant is not greater than that of the model. We consider the case where this condition is not satisfied. In this case, although any feedback law cannot cansel the influence of the inputs of the model on the error, the high-gain feedback based on the singular perturbation theory is available. It is shown that, by using the high-gain feedback with some small positive parameter ε, the error will remain o(ε). Finally, the efficiency of the proposed control law is illustrated by a numerical simulation.
